The Test Solutions Center (TSC) team within the Hardware Discipline Center is a multi-discipline organization that provides test solutions to support production lines for our entire missile portfolio. The software team within TSC is responsible for developing advanced windows application solutions for all Raytheon products. We are hands-on, designing with the latest technology and tools, and integrating state-of-the-art software solutions with the most advanced engineering systems in the world. TSC products are in engineering labs, in the field, and in production environments utilized for weapon system products. TSC has job opportunities across all phases of the engineering lifecycle, including demonstrations, early engineering tests, design verification tests, production, and post-production sustainment.

The Software Engineer II position is focused on the design, development, integration, and maintenance of software as a part of on-site factory support of systems to support weapon system product development. The selected candidate will develop applications, libraries, and instrument drivers using the software style, development language, and integrated development environment specified by the organization.

The selected candidate will contribute to multidiscipline engineering teams. Typical work involves the development of both engineering and production equipment, environments, and systems. As such, the candidate will contribute to the completion of all stages of product development for RMD weapon system products. They will be expected to work, either as a part of a team or independently, to design, develop, and implement system level applications in support of producing and maintaining weapon system products.

The Digital Products Configuration Management (DPCM), formerly known as Software Configuration Management (SWCM), department, is hiring a Principal Digital Product Configuration Management Engineer. The DPCM department provides innovative solutions through automation, continuous improvement, and a skilled workforce providing support for all digital products.

The term 'Digital Product' (DP) refers to, but is not limited to, the following software types and their associated data and documentation: embedded (tactical) software, applications, Built-in Test (BIT) software, reprogramming tools, simulation software, test equipment, configurable logic, Application-Specific Integrated Circuit (ASIC) design, analytical tools used to formally qualify deliverable artifacts,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) system models or related artifacts, Free Open Source Software (FOSS), and Commercial Off-The-Shelf (COTS) software.
